None or the sirens had any children,and their father -when they aren't said to be the children of Gaia alone - is Achelous, god of that river and generally thought of as a god of fresh water, their mother being either;

Melpomene the Muse of tragedy.

Terpsichore the Muse of choral song and dancing.

Sterope a daughter of Atlas.

They were sisters, names being;

Thelxiope

Thelxinoe

Thelxipea

Molpe

Pisinoe

Aglaophonus

Aglaope

Parthenope

Ligea

Leucosia

For all that they were feared monsters of the sea, it does not seem that they were born of the sea.
